Exploring the Mechanics of Automatic Cleaning

At their core, automatic hoovers are designed to navigate your home autonomously and clean floorings without direct human control. They achieve this through a combination of advanced innovations, including sensing units, navigation systems, and cleaning systems.

The majority of automatic hoovers operate on rechargeable batteries and feature a charging dock. When their battery is low, or after finishing a cleaning cycle, they immediately return to their dock to recharge. The cleaning process itself generally involves:

Navigation: This is probably the most essential aspect. Automatic hoovers employ different navigation techniques to map and traverse your home. Early designs typically used bump-and-go navigation, arbitrarily bouncing around up until they covered an area. However, contemporary designs make use of more sophisticated systems like:
S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ping): This innovation allows the robot to build a map of its surroundings in real-time while at the same time determining its area within that map.L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ging): LiDAR utilizes laser beams to measure ranges and develop highly precise maps, allowing effective and systematic cleaning patterns.VSLAM (Visual Simultaneous Localization and Mapping): Similar to SLAM but depends on cams rather of lasers to view and map the environment.Gyroscope and Odometry: Some models integrate gyroscopes and wheel sensing units (odometry) to track movement and instructions, improving navigation.
Sensing units: A variety of sensing units are integrated to help the robot hoover communicate securely and successfully with its environment. These typically include:
Cliff sensors: Prevent the robot from falling down stairs or ledges.Obstacle sensors: Detect barriers like furniture, walls, and pet bowls, allowing the robot to browse around them.Wall sensing units: Enable the robot to follow walls and edges for extensive edge cleaning.Dirt detection sensors: In some sophisticated models, these sensors can detect areas with greater concentrations of dirt and debris, prompting more concentrated cleaning.
Cleaning Mechanisms: Automatic hoovers normally employ a mix of:
Rotating brushes: These brushes sweep dirt and debris from the floor towards the suction inlet. They often come in different styles for different floor types.Side brushes: Extend the cleaning reach to edges and corners.Suction: Generates airflow to raise dirt and dust into the dustbin. Suction power varies in between designs.Mopping pads: Some hybrid models incorporate mopping performance, using damp pads to gently mop tough floors after or during vacuuming.
Kinds Of Automatic Hoovers: From Basic to Feature-Rich

The marketplace for automatic hoovers is diverse, dealing with a large range of needs and budgets. They can be broadly classified based on their features and performances:

Basic Models: These are normally entry-level robotics focusing on fundamental cleaning. They often utilize bump-and-go navigation or simpler gyroscope-based navigation. They are generally more affordable however may lack advanced features like mapping, app control, or strong suction.

Mid-Range Models: Offering a balance between price and functions, these models often incorporate smart navigation (SLAM, LiDAR, or VSLAM), app connectivity, and scheduling abilities. They normally offer more efficient cleaning patterns and better barrier avoidance than fundamental models.

High-End Models: These are the premium offerings, loaded with innovative innovations and functions. They frequently boast superior navigation, mapping abilities, multi-floor mapping (remembering maps for different levels of your home), personalized cleaning zones, "no-go" zones (areas you desire to avoid cleaning), self-emptying dustbins, and integration with smart home ecosystems.

Hybrid Vacuum-Mop Models: These versatile robotics combine vacuuming and mopping performances in one gadget. They can vacuum up dry debris and after that mop tough floors with a wet pad, offering a two-in-one cleaning solution.

Preserving Your Automatic Hoover

To ensure optimum efficiency and durability, routine upkeep is vital:
Empty the Dustbin Regularly: Frequent emptying avoids the dustbin from overfilling and preserves suction performance. Self-emptying designs reduce this task considerably.Tidy Brushes and Filters: Hair and particles can accumulate on brushes and filters, minimizing cleaning efficiency. Tidy them frequently as per the manufacturer's directions.Examine Sensors: Ensure sensing units are clean and devoid of dust or blockages for proper navigation.Replace Parts as Needed: Brushes and filters will eventually require replacement. Follow the maker's recommendations for replacement periods.Battery Care: While normally long-lasting, batteries have a life expectancy. Follow charging directions and prevent leaving the robot continually on the charger once fully charged to take full advantage of battery health.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Automatic Hoovers

Q1: Are automatic hoovers as effective as standard vacuum cleaners?A: While suction power has substantially enhanced in current designs, the majority of automatic hoovers may not match the deep cleaning power of a high-end traditional upright or canister vacuum, specifically for greatly soiled areas or thick carpets. However, for everyday cleaning and upkeep, they are typically very reliable.

Q2: Can automatic hoovers clean all kinds of floorings?A: Many automatic hoovers are designed to work well on different floor types, consisting of wood, tile, laminate, and low-pile carpets. However, some designs are better suited for particular floor types. Check product specifications to ensure compatibility with your floor covering.

Q3: How long do automatic hoover batteries last?A: Battery life varies depending on the design and cleaning mode. The majority of models offer between 60 to 120 minutes of run time on a single charge. Higher-end designs may provide even longer battery life.

Q4: Are automatic hoovers noisy?A: Noise levels differ amongst designs. Typically, they are quieter than standard vacuum, but some noise is still generated. Think about models with lower decibel rankings if noise level of sensitivity is a concern.

Q5: Do automatic hoovers require a great deal of upkeep?A: Routine maintenance is essential, including clearing the dustbin, cleaning brushes and filters, and periodically examining sensors. Self-emptying models decrease the frequency of dustbin emptying.

Q6: Can automatic hoovers manage pet hair effectively?A: Yes, lots of automatic hoovers are particularly created for pet owners and are extremely reliable at choosing up pet hair. Search for designs with functions like tangle-free brushes and strong suction, frequently marketed as "pet hair" models.

Q7: What takes place if an automatic hoover gets stuck?A: Modern automatic hoovers are geared up with challenge sensing units and navigation systems to reduce getting stuck. Nevertheless, they might occasionally get stuck on cords, loose rugs, or in tight areas. Many designs will stop and signify if they are stuck, frequently via an app alert.

Q8: Can I control an automatic hoover from another location?A: Many mid-range and high-end models come with smart device app connectivity, enabling remote control, scheduling, monitoring cleaning status, and accessing functions like zone cleaning and no-go zones.
